How Much Does a Supply Operations Manager Make in Boca Del Rio?

A Supply Operations Manager working in Boca del Rio will typically earn around 502,200 MXN per year, and this can range from the lowest average salary of about 231,000 MXN to the highest average salary of 798,900 MXN.

Average Annual Salary502,200 MXN
Average Monthly Salary41,850 MXN
Average Lowest Salary231,000 MXN
Lowest Monthly Salary19,250 MXN
Average Highest Salary798,900 MXN
Highest Monthly Salary66,575 MXN

These are average salaries for a Supply Operations Manager in Boca del Rio and include benefits such as housing and transport. It's also possible for a Supply Operations Manager to earn more or less than the average salaries shown above.

Supply Operations Manager Salary by Experience Level in Boca del Rio

The most important factor in determining your salary after the specific profession is the number of years experience you have. It stands to reason that more years of experience will result in a higher wage.

We have researched the average Supply Operations Manager salary based on years of experience to give you an idea of how the average changes once you've worked for a certain amount of time.

  • 0 - 2 Years Experience. A Supply Operations Manager in Boca del Rio that has less than two years of experience can expect to earn somewhere in the region of 263,200 MXN.
  • 2 - 5 Years Experience. With two to five years of experience the average Supply Operations Manager salary would increase to 352,000 MXN.
  • 5 - 10 Years Experience. From five to ten years of experience as a Supply Operations Manager, the average salary would be 518,300 MXN.
  • 10 - 15 Years Experience. Once you have more than ten years of experience the average salary reaches around 633,100 MXN.
  • 15 - 20 Years Experience. A Supply Operations Manager with 15 to 20 years of experience can earn an average of 688,900 MXN.
  • 20+ Years Experience. For a Supply Operations Manager with more than 20 years, the expected average salary increases to 744,700 MXN.

Supply Operations Manager Average Pay Raise in Boca del Rio

In many countries, an annual pay raise is often given to employees to reward their service with a salary increase.

From our research, we can see that the average pay raise for a Supply Operations Manager in Boca del Rio is around 12% every 18 months.

The national average pay raise across all professions and industries in Mexico is around 8% every 18 months.

In this case, we can see that the number of months between the average pay raise is higher than the typical 12 months.

To make the data more meaningful, we can calculate what the approximate annual pay raise would be using a simple formula:

Annual Increase = ( Increase Rate ÷ Months ) × 12

So for this example, it would be:

Annual Increase = ( 12 ÷ 18 ) × 12  = 8%

What this means is that a Supply Operations Manager in Boca del Rio can expect to receive an average pay raise of around 8% every 12 months.

What are the Types of Bonus?

There are a number of difference types of bonus you can receive in a job. Including:

  • Individual performance bonus - This is a bonus that is awarded to an individual employee for general performance in the job. It's the most common type of bonus.
  • Company performance bonus - This is a bonus that is awarded to a company employees to share profit with the staff.
  • Goal based bonus - This is a bonus that is awarded to an individual employee (or a team) for achieving specific goals, objectives, or milestones.
  • Holiday bonus - This type of bonus is usually paid around the holidays, often the end of the year, and is a token of appreciation for the hard work throughout the year.
